Initial Shelf Registration. The Company and the Guarantors shall prepare and file with the SEC a Registration Statement for an offering to be made on a continuous basis pursuant to Rule 415 covering all of the Registrable Securities (the "Initial Shelf Registration"). If the Company and the Guarantors have not yet filed an Exchange Offer, the Company and the Guarantors shall file with the SEC the Initial Shelf Registration on or prior to the Filing Date. Otherwise, the Company and the Guarantors shall use their best efforts to file the Initial Shelf Registration within 20 days of the delivery of the Shelf Notice or as promptly as possible following the request of the Initial Purchaser. The Initial Shelf Registration shall be on Form S-1 or another appropriate form permitting regis- tration of such Registrable Securities for resale by such holders in the manner or manners designated by them (including, without limitation, one or more underwritten offerings).
